General Mechanics registers a set of industrial fluids, each with a chemical formula, temperature parameter, and acid/base classification. Every fluid has a source block, flowing fluid, and a bucket item. Fluid properties such as temperature are used by machines and chemical processing recipes.
Acidic fluids (Sulfuric Acid, Hydrochloric Acid, Nitric Acid) are hazardous. Handle them carefully in piping systems and avoid uncontained spills. Machines interacting with acidic fluids may require corrosion-resistant components.

Petroleum Derivatives

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
Crude OilC₁₂H₂₃298Unrefined petroleum; feedstock for refining
Refined OilC₁₀H₂₂298Processed crude oil; lighter hydrocarbon fraction
GasolineC₈H₁₈298High-energy fuel; volatile flammable liquid
DieselC₁₂H₂₃298Heavy fuel fraction; used for engines and furnaces
KeroseneC₁₂H₂₆298Mid-range distillate; jet fuel precursor
NaphthaC₇H₁₆298Light fraction; feedstock for petrochemical synthesis

Alcohols & Solvents

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
MethanolCH₃OH298Simple alcohol; solvent and chemical feedstock
EthanolC₂H₅OH298Fermentation alcohol; fuel additive and solvent
AcetoneC₃H₆O298Ketone solvent; used in polymer processing
GlycerolC₃H₈O₃298Viscous polyol; byproduct of biodiesel production

Aromatics & Hydrocarbons

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
BenzeneC₆H₆298Aromatic hydrocarbon; plastic and chemical feedstock
TolueneC₇H₈298Aromatic solvent; used in dye and explosive synthesis
XyleneC₈H₁₀298Aromatic solvent; feedstock for PET and resins
EthyleneC₂H₄273Gaseous alkene; monomer for polyethylene (PE)
PropyleneC₃H₆273Gaseous alkene; monomer for polypropylene (PP)
ButadieneC₄H₆273Gaseous diene; monomer for synthetic rubber and ABS
StyreneC₈H₈298Aromatic monomer; feedstock for polystyrene (PS)

Acids & Bases

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
Sulfuric AcidH₂SO₄298Strong acid; used in metal etching and electrolysis
Hydrochloric AcidHCl298Strong acid; used in metal pickling and ore leaching
Nitric AcidHNO₃298Strong oxidizing acid; used in nitration reactions
AmmoniaNH₃298Weak base (gas/solution); nitrogen source for synthesis
Liquid AmmoniaNH₃(l)240Cryogenic liquid base; refrigerant and solvent

Gases & Elemental Fluids

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
HydrogenH₂20Lightest element; fuel and reducing agent
OxygenO₂90Oxidizer; required for combustion reactions
NitrogenN₂77Inert gas; used for purging and cooling
Carbon MonoxideCO82Toxic reducing gas; Fischer–Tropsch feedstock
Carbon DioxideCO₂195Inert gas; produced by combustion and fermentation

Water Variants & Cryogenics

NameFormulaTemperature (K)Properties
Distilled WaterH₂O298Purified water; used in chemical reactions and cooling
Heavy WaterD₂O298Deuterium oxide; used in nuclear reactor processes
SteamH₂O(g)373Gaseous water; used in turbines and thermal machines
Liquid NitrogenN₂(l)77Cryogenic coolant; used for rapid cooling processes
Liquid OxygenO₂(l)90Cryogenic oxidizer; used in high-energy reactions

Fluid Buckets

Every fluid has a corresponding bucket item (e.g., Crude Oil Bucket, Sulfuric Acid Bucket). Buckets stack to 1 and return an empty bucket when used, following standard Minecraft bucket behavior.
